Global Leader in Desalination Plant Business
Shuaibah Ph 3. in Saudi ArabiaWorld Largest Desalination Plant (194 MIGD)
Fujairah Plant in UAEWorld First Hybrid (MSF+RO) Power & Desalination Plant (660 MW + 100 MIGD)
Umm Al Nar Plant in UAEWorld Shortest Delivery Desalination Plant (62.5 MIGD)
Al Taweelah A2 Plant in UAEWorld First IWPP Desalination Plant (50 MIGD)

Increased energy efficiency and Decreasing unit costs
Larger unit sizes with Improved RO elements and MEDHybrid processLess material, chemicals and footprint
More BOOT/BOO contracts (Users prefer to buy water not plants)
Renewable Energy (Solar/Wind) + RO Desalination
More Water Reuse and Aquifer Storage for Recovery

2G Strategy
Growth of people
Growth of business
Beneficial Circle
2G strategy is core value of the Doosan group.
It means... “Growth of people can create business opportunity and people are improved by growth of business.”
In other words, 2G strategy isbeneficial circulation Structurebetween people and business
